2019 Wimbledon Championships – Girls' singles

Daria Snigur won the title, defeating Alexa Noel 6−4, 6−4 in the final.

Iga Świątek was the defending champion, but chose to compete in the women's singles competition instead. She lost to Viktorija Golubic in the first round.
